Output 7be5eff3ce593015bb6c6bbbee2caa541f2cfd630b19d30f5cfce0f4818cb617:6

value
107463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b98b96bdecc2609b2459f0371d8b44d4173aabb OP_EQUAL
address
3QdLVAT56WxPpmyexRghai4Qk5pJHeWaPJ
transaction
7be5eff3ce593015bb6c6bbbee2caa541f2cfd630b19d30f5cfce0f4818cb617
confirmations
23354
spent
true